HC Deb 28 February 2001 vol 363 c704W
Mr. Drew

To ask the Secretary of State for Trade and Industry what plans he has to investigate credit companies' power to blacklist individuals. [150852]

Dr. Howells

I do not have any current plans to investigate such companies. The Director General of Fair Trading has a duty under the Consumer Credit Act 1974 to review and advise my right hon. Friend the Secretary of State for Trade and Industry about developments in the UK credit market. If he makes any recommendations, I will study them carefully.
